Output 1da3497fc4d32077475c826146167b1caa541f9df2f892bc84b13b122bc97543:109

value
33796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59aedfb6e5eef9b3516c542abe424477dbe1be28 OP_EQUAL
address
39sDZ4rDfeZHoBio7WyTwC3Jwj4kEZtCn4
transaction
1da3497fc4d32077475c826146167b1caa541f9df2f892bc84b13b122bc97543
confirmations
243433
spent
true